Red Stag Hunting
The Red Stag is one of the most iconic big game species available in Texas. These majestic European deer have adapted beautifully to the Hill Country’s varied terrain and rich food sources, allowing them to grow massive, multi-tined antlers.
Why Hunt Red Stag in the Texas Hill Country?
- World-Class Antlers: Mature stags often score over 300 inches.
- Exciting Rut Hunts: From September to November, stags roar and spar for dominance.
- Majestic Presence: Heavy-bodied, vocal, and regal—an unforgettable hunt.
Hunting Methods
- Calling and Stalking: Use vocalizations to draw in dominant stags during the rut.
- Spot-and-Stalk: Locate stags in open areas, then plan a stealthy approach.
- Stand Hunts: Set up in known travel corridors for bow or rifle harvests.
